引言
DES考试,即数据加密标准考试,是检验考生在数据加密领域知识和技能的重要手段。随着信息技术的快速发展,掌握数据加密技术已成为信息安全领域从业者的必备技能。本文将深入解析DES考试,并提供一招通关秘诀,帮助考生轻松应对。
DES考试概述
1. 考试目的
DES考试旨在评估考生对数据加密标准(Data Encryption Standard,DES)的掌握程度,包括DES算法原理、加密过程、密钥管理等方面。
2. 考试内容
考试内容主要包括:
- DES算法原理
- DES加密和解密过程
- DES密钥生成与分配
- DES算法的安全性分析
- DES在实际应用中的案例
3. 考试形式
DES考试通常采用笔试形式,包括选择题、填空题、简答题和编程题等。
DES考试通关秘诀
1. 理解DES算法原理
要应对DES考试,首先要深入理解DES算法的原理。以下是DES算法的核心要点:
- DES算法是一种对称密钥加密算法,使用56位密钥进行加密和解密。
- DES算法将64位明文分成8组,每组8位。
- 每组明文经过16轮迭代加密,最终生成64位密文。
2. 掌握DES加密和解密过程
熟悉DES加密和解密过程对于应对考试至关重要。以下是DES加密和解密过程的步骤:
加密过程:
- 将明文分成8组,每组8位。
- 对每组明文进行初始置换(IP)。
- 进行16轮迭代加密,每轮包括置换、替换和混淆操作。
- 对加密后的64位密文进行逆初始置换(IP^-1)。
解密过程:
- 将密文分成8组,每组8位。
- 对每组密文进行逆初始置换(IP^-1)。
- 进行16轮迭代解密,每轮包括置换、替换和混淆操作。
- 对解密后的64位明文进行初始置换(IP)。
3. 熟悉DES密钥管理
密钥管理是DES考试的重点内容之一。以下是一些密钥管理的要点:
- 密钥长度为56位,其中8位用于奇偶校验。
- 密钥生成过程中,需要从原始密钥中提取子密钥。
- 子密钥用于加密和解密过程。
4. 学习DES算法的安全性分析
了解DES算法的安全性分析有助于考生在考试中更好地回答相关问题。以下是DES算法安全性分析的关键点:
- DES算法存在一定的弱点,如密钥长度较短、存在弱密钥和半弱密钥等。
- DES算法已逐渐被更安全的加密算法所取代,如AES。
5. 案例分析
通过学习DES在实际应用中的案例,考生可以更好地理解DES算法的原理和应用。以下是一些案例分析:
- DES在银行系统中的应用
- DES在电子邮件加密中的应用
- DES在数字签名中的应用
总结
通过以上分析,我们了解到DES考试的重点内容和通关秘诀。只要考生深入理解DES算法原理,掌握加密和解密过程,熟悉密钥管理,学习安全性分析,并关注实际应用案例,就能轻松应对DES考试。祝广大考生顺利通过考试,成为数据加密领域的佼佼者!
